Many newer companies may call it “concrete leveling,” but most of the time you do not actually want concrete perfectly level. Driveways are typically designed with pitch to move water away from the home and garage. The goal is to lift the concrete back toward its original grade while maintaining proper drainage.

Traditional SlabJacking has been a tried and proven method for lifting settled concrete for decades.
At HowellSlabJacking, experience matters. The material itself is only one part of the process. Knowing where to place the holes and how much material to pump beneath the slab is where decades of experience become important.
We inspect the driveway and identify areas that have lost support beneath the slab. Small access holes are drilled in strategic locations.
Material is pumped beneath the driveway under pressure to fill voids and carefully lift the slab.
The slab is brought back toward its proper position while maintaining drainage and matching surrounding sections as closely as possible.
Most residential jobs can often be completed in less than a day.

We use the more accurate term: Concrete Lifting. Driveways are usually designed with pitch for drainage, so the goal is not always perfectly level concrete. The goal is usually restoring the slab toward its original position while maintaining proper water flow.
Every driveway is different. Factors such as access, location, voids, and the amount of settlement affect pricing. Most residential SlabJacking jobs generally run between $600–$1,900, although larger jobs can be more.
Not necessarily. We have lifted tens of thousands of slabs over the past 35+ years that someone else originally poured. SlabJacking often costs significantly less and avoids the mess of tearing out and replacing concrete.
Nothing is permanent. However, when erosion is controlled and proper support exists beneath the slab, many lifted slabs remain stable for many years.
In most cases, your driveway is ready to use again shortly after the work is completed. This makes it a convenient option for homeowners who don’t want to deal with long wait times or major disruption.
We drill small, dime-sized access holes that are patched once the lifting is complete. The patches are minimal and blend in with the surrounding concrete, making them far less noticeable than tearing out and replacing the slab.
Most homeowners barely notice them—and they’re a small tradeoff for avoiding a full demolition, major mess, and mismatched new concrete.
Concrete leveling addresses the root problem by restoring support underneath the slab. While no solution can stop all future ground movement, properly stabilizing the base helps provide long-term results and prevents the issue from continuing to worsen.
